Output eab24ca9be835808fe97b5bb8d7d5272bb3570b055c027be167f03a9c4b50603:63

value
675405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4be2592f6f05492dcb38512a621689d3fdf3002 OP_EQUAL
address
3Gi6Xdh1GpC2kgvMVM8bogwDqeodiWvtZi
transaction
eab24ca9be835808fe97b5bb8d7d5272bb3570b055c027be167f03a9c4b50603
spent
true